Output d3ecc77a4b5953160c2e45148c0fc6390e81f254d39f64a69a3f9d66b0eacbd4:30

value
62415600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f2c281f9e62ea042fddea803d2089f8fff8546 OP_EQUAL
address
3KHEUd11HXiERyySp9FTo1aX6ieLvcsUz1
transaction
d3ecc77a4b5953160c2e45148c0fc6390e81f254d39f64a69a3f9d66b0eacbd4
spent
true